1. Precision and Complexity

One of the standout benefits of lost foam casting products is their ability to create highly intricate designs with remarkable precision. Unlike traditional sand casting, where patterns are created out of metal or wood, lost foam casting utilizes a foam pattern that evaporates during the pouring process. This means that manufacturers can achieve more detailed and complex geometries, which are otherwise challenging to produce. For example, automotive parts often require tightly designed components, and lost foam casting allows engineers to create these with precision, enhancing both performance and aesthetic appeal.

Example: Automotive Applications

A common application of lost foam casting products can be seen in producing engine blocks and other critical components. The method's versatility allows car manufacturers to develop shapes that lead to better fuel efficiency and weight reduction, a crucial aspect in modern vehicle design.

2. Cost-Effectiveness

Cost efficiency is another significant benefit of lost foam casting. The process reduces the need for complex tooling and mold creation, which can be both time-consuming and expensive. With lost foam casting, the foam patterns can be produced quickly and at a lower cost, translating to reduced overall production expenses.

3. Environmental Considerations

As sustainability becomes a cornerstone of manufacturing practices, lost foam casting products stand out due to their relatively lower environmental impact. The method produces less waste compared to traditional casting methods, as the foam is completely consumed during the casting process. Moreover, the materials used can often be recycled, making it a more sustainable choice.

4. Improved Surface Finish

The lost foam casting process typically results in a superior surface finish compared to traditional molds. The foam pattern creates a smooth surface that translates directly to the final product, minimizing the need for additional finishing processes. This saves time and labor, allowing companies to bring their products to market more quickly.

Common Questions About Lost Foam Casting Products

What types of materials can be used in lost foam casting?

Lost foam casting products can be made from various metals, including aluminum, magnesium, and cast iron. The choice of metal often depends on the intended application and the specific properties required.

Is lost foam casting suitable for small production runs?

Yes, lost foam casting is ideal for both large-scale and small production runs. Its flexibility and relatively low setup costs make it a great choice for prototypes and custom parts.

How does lost foam casting compare to other casting methods?

While traditional casting methods can be more suitable for simple shapes due to lower initial costs, lost foam casting offers advantages in precision, complexity, and surface finish, making it preferable for intricate designs.
